By joining Verizon as a leader in the Corporate Communications organization, you will have the opportunity to craft and drive the narrative that highlights our commitment to innovation, a differentiated customer experience, and a connected future.  You will oversee strategic planning and operational excellence, ensuring our storytelling and initiatives align with our organizational goals and resonates with key stakeholders. 

What you'll be doing:

  • Developing, advising, and implementing strategic long-term and short-term communication plans that align with Verizon’s priorities and drive objectives.

  • Managing large-scale budgets, ensuring optimal allocation of resources and maximizing value. 

  • Providing accurate forecasting and making strategic recommendations for budget optimization.

  • Enhancing operational processes to ensure efficient execution of communication strategies.

  • Identifying KPIs and utilizing metrics system to measure effectiveness; analyzing, informing, and optimizing our go-to-market communication strategies.

  • Working with internal teams to ensure cohesive and integrated communications efforts.

  • Leading and managing projects, ensuring timely delivery and alignment with strategic goals.

  • Collaborating cross-functionally to address the needs of key stakeholders, including investors, customers, employees, and partners, ensuring these needs are reflected in both long-term and short-term strategic plans.

What we’re looking for:

You'll need to have:

  • Bachelor’s degree or four or more years of work experience.

  • Eight or more years of relevant experience required, demonstrated through one or a combination of work and/or military experience, or specialized training.

  • Experience in corporate communications, public relations, and executive communications.

  • Experience in strategic planning and operations within a corporate communications environment.

Where you’ll be working

In this hybrid role, you'll have a defined work location that includes work from home and a minimum eight assigned office days per month that will be set by your manager.
